Choosing ⁣the Right⁢ Style for Your Venue

When​ selecting wedding shoes, it’s essential to consider ⁣the ⁣ overall theme and simplicity of your venue. As a notable example, if⁤ you’re ⁤having a rustic outdoor wedding,⁢ opt for shoes ‍that complement the⁢ natural surroundings. ‍On the other hand,‍ for a formal indoor⁤ venue, elegant heels ‌or refined⁢ flats can enhance your refined style. here are ​some styles to think about ​based on ‍different settings:

  • Beach Venue: Lightweight sandals or chic espadrilles.
  • Garden Setting: Floral-embellished⁣ flats ⁢or block-heeled shoes.
  • Ballroom Reception: ⁢Classic stilettos or‍ embellished pumps.
  • Winery ‌Wedding: Stylish wedges or lace-up ankle ‌boots.

Additionally,ensure that your shoe choice​ not ‍only matches ⁢the aesthetic of your venue⁢ but ‍also aligns with comfort and practicality. You don’t wont⁤ to‌ be hobbling​ through grass or sinking into‌ sandy beaches!⁢ A quick table of⁢ considerations might help:

Venue Type Shoe Options Comfort Tips
Beach Flat ⁤Sandals Choose⁤ durable materials⁤ that can withstand‍ sand.
Garden Wedges Consider the risk of sinking into soil; choose sturdy styles.
Indoor Heels or Flats Ensure a ‌comfortable fit to enjoy dancing all‍ night.

Understanding Fit and​ Comfort to Avoid Discomfort

When it comes to⁣ wedding shoes,​ the⁣ fit and comfort of your ​choice can make or ‌break your big ‌day.⁣ Selecting‍ a pair that feels ⁢good from⁢ the start is crucial, as you’ll likely be ‍on⁢ your ⁣feet for hours. Here are some⁤ tips to ​ensure you ‍make‍ the ⁣right choice:

  • Know Your Size: Sizes can‌ vary between brands⁣ and⁢ styles, so always try on several‌ pairs, even if you think you already ‌know your size.
  • Sock‍ Check: ⁤Wear the same type of hosiery you plan to use on your wedding day when trying on shoes.
  • Walk It ⁢Out: Take a stroll in the shoes around the store to assess comfort and⁢ fit; pay⁤ attention‌ to​ any pinching ‍or rubbing.
  • Consider ⁢Arch Support: Opt for styles ‍that offer ⁢appropriate support⁢ if‌ you‍ have specific foot concerns.

It’s not just about‍ appearance; investing time in understanding your personal comfort needs ⁢can save ​you from‌ a⁤ day filled with ‍discomfort. To ‍help ‍clarify what to look for, refer to the following table:

Aspect Considerations
Material Choose breathable fabrics like leather or ⁢satin ​to avoid blisters.
Heel Height A moderate heel height ⁣is frequently enough best; practice‍ walking⁣ in your chosen height.
Toe ⁢Box Ensure there’s enough⁣ space in the toe area ⁢to avoid pinching.

Materials Matter: Selecting Shoes for Different⁤ Weather Conditions

Selecting the right shoes for different weather​ conditions is essential to⁣ ensure ‌you remain comfortable and stylish on your big ‍day. ⁤When considering your options,it’s crucial to think about ​the material ⁤of⁤ the shoes.⁢ For warmer weather, breathable ⁢fabrics like canvas or light leather ⁣can prevent overheating⁣ and ​discomfort. In‍ contrast, if your⁣ wedding⁣ is taking⁢ place during⁣ colder months, opt for shoes ​made ‍of⁣ insulated leather or suede.These materials help retain warmth and can add a touch of ‍elegance to your look. Additionally, shoes ⁢with water-resistant ‌coatings are a​ smart choice for ⁤unpredictable weather, ensuring you stay dry⁢ if⁣ the skies open up on your special ⁣day.

Furthermore, the sole material plays a meaningful role in your overall comfort ⁤and stability. Consider the ‍following⁤ when selecting shoes:

  • rubber Soles: ⁤Excellent grip, ideal for wet​ conditions.
  • Leather Soles: ⁣ Classy ⁣and breathable but can be⁤ slippery.
  • Foam Soles: Provide extra ⁤cushioning⁢ for long events.
Weather ⁣Condition Recommended Material Best Sole Type
Warm Canvas / Light ​Leather Rubber
Cold insulated Leather / Suede Leather
Rainy Water-Resistant Fabric Rubber

Planning Ahead:⁣ Timing Your Rental to Ensure the Perfect Pair

when⁤ it comes to ensuring you have ‍the perfect pair of ‌rental wedding shoes,⁢ timing is everything. ‍Start your ‍planning at​ least three months ⁢in advance. This allows you ample ​time to ‌explore various rental options, fittings, ​and adjustments. Additionally, scheduling multiple try-on sessions can definitely⁢ help you find the style that not only complements your dress but also offers the necessary comfort for a long day.⁣ While browsing,‌ consider creating a⁣ wish list of styles‌ and⁤ colors, keeping your venue ⁣and overall theme⁣ in mind. You wouldn’t want to ‍be regrettably mismatched on your​ big day!

Be mindful of seasonal trends as well.Rental stores frequently enough update their inventory,so ⁢securing your shoes ‌during the off-peak months ‍coudl yield a⁤ wider ​selection. Prepare to ‍reserve your shoes ⁣ early to ‌avoid last-minute ‌panic. Here are a few key tips to consider:

  • Book early: ‌Aim for a rental ⁣at least ‍ 6 weeks prior to the wedding.
  • Fit over fashion: ⁤ Prioritize comfort, ​especially ⁤for all-day wear.
  • Multiple ⁤fittings: Don’t hesitate to ask for adjustments, if necessary.
Timeframe Action Item
3 Months Before Start researching⁤ rental ⁣options
6 Weeks Before Finalize your choice⁤ and place‍ the order
1 Week Before Ensure all fittings are ​done
